The MS2N06-E0BRN-CSSL0-NNNNN-NN is a flange-mounted synchronous servo motor with a nominal torque of 4.2 Nm. Manufactured by Bosch Rexroth Indramat under the MS2N Synchronous Servo Motors series, it operates at a nominal speed of 3000 rpm. It features natural convection cooling and IP65 protection.

Product Description:

The Bosch Rexroth Indramat MS2N06-E0BRN-CSSL0-NNNNN-NN servo motor with 1.3 kW power is designed to meet the demands of contemporary automation systems, where stability, accuracy, and responsiveness are key requirements. It can be operated at 400 V and, therefore, can be easily incorporated into a typical three-phase electrical system, thus suitable for various industrial conditions. It is designed to facilitate a highly controlled motion, with smooth acceleration and deceleration, which makes it particularly useful for operations where repeatable and precise movements are required.

This MS2N motor can operate perfectly in synchrony with the control signals due to the synchronous servo design of the motor, unlike conventional motors. This is especially useful in applications where precision is important in performance, like in material handling, packaging systems, or even with semiconductor manufacturing, where just a small variance can result in significant performance loss. This motor is powerful yet compact and provides reliable efficiency and control of the high-precision automation units. Natural convection takes place due to the natural flow of air that occurs because of the natural temperature and density variations within air itself. Additionally, any external power source, such as a fan or a pump, is not necessary. This simple but effective cooling method is ideal for applications where space or noise is a concern, and it reduces the need for additional maintenance units. Natural convection cooling ensures that the motor remains efficient and reliable even during long periods of operation.

The MS2N06 motor is equipped with a single-turn absolute encoder, which provides precise feedback about the motor's position. The motor also features a rotatable connector, making it easier to integrate into different systems.
